A high growth consultancy in the UK seeks a Technical Lead skilled in cloud-native engineering. You will guide teams, make architectural decisions, and remain hands-on, contributing to DevOps pipelines and mentoring engineers.
Ideal candidates have extensive experience with Python, AWS or Azure, and containers like Docker and Kubernetes. This is an opportunity to influence technical delivery while working in a flexible environment with remote collaboration.

How to prepare for a job interview at Inara
✨Know Your Tech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on your Python, Kubernetes, and cloud platforms like AWS or Azure. Be ready to discuss your past projects and how you've used these technologies to solve real-world problems. This will show that you're not just familiar with the tools, but that you can apply them effectively.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
As a Technical Lead, you'll be guiding teams and making architectural decisions. Prepare examples of how you've mentored engineers or led projects in the past. Highlight your ability to communicate complex ideas clearly and how you've fostered collaboration within your team.
✨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ions
Expect questions that ask you to solve hypothetical problems or make decisions based on specific scenarios. Think about how you would approach challenges in cloud-native engineering and be ready to explain your thought process. This will demonstrate your critical thinking and problem-solving skills.
✨Emphasise Your DevOps Experience
Since the role involves contributing to DevOps pipelines, be prepared to discuss your experience with CI/CD processes and automation tools. Share specific examples of how you've improved deployment processes or enhanced system reliability, as this will show your hands-on expertise in a crucial area.
